Industry Overview

The Retail Trade sector employs 26,703,360 Americans and faces elevated AI displacement risk with a composite score of 56/100. Key automation drivers include ai automation increasing and demand shifting to higher-skill roles. The industry is currently in the unknown phase of AI adoption, with 573,880 jobs projected to be lost by 2030. The net employment impact is expected to be relatively modest compared to other sectors.
